New Hampshire Deer Take as of 11/29/20 is 12,275 (VIDEO)

Sunday 11/29/2020

New Hampshire Fish and Game Department deer project leader Dan Bergeron reports 12,275 deer taken so far this season. This is a 9 percent increase over last year's 11,289 at this same date. This is the highest take to date in the last 9 years. No doubt this year's take will be in the top five ever taken. The unseasonably warm fall with NO snow anywhere in New Hampshire right now has certainly dampened this year's take. New Hampshire's deer season closes on different date depending where you are hunting. For most of the state the regular deer season will end on December 6th I believe. Always check the NH Fish and Game web site to be certain.
